From very early on we become trained in how to behave, how to look; the rules of how to conform to society’s ’one size fits all’ structure. As citizens we are expected to go along with these rules, which change after occasion and situation where each situation has its own implicit rules to conform to. These masks inspired by the socially constructed masks that gets pressured upon us; a facade that can crack and reveals the raw unfiltered side. All masks are made from resin.
